Midyan/Gulf of Aqaba

The aim of this fieldtrip was to study the structural style of the GOA and associated deformation within the basement as well as the syn to post rift section outcropping in the Midyan peninsula, Saudi Arabia.

Miocene sediments offset by a normal fault in the Midyan Peninsula. Antoine Delaunay as scale. Behind him see the sismites within the redbeds.

Drone Photo: Jakub Fedorik.

Top view image of distributed strike-slip deformation offsetting dikes in the basement, Midyan Peninsula. High deformation is also reflected in dense fracture pattern.

Drone Photo: Jakub Fedorik

Strike-slip fault of the Aqaba Gulf onshore fault system, Midyan Peninsula. Jakub Fedorik as scale. Presence of cataclasites (centimetric to metric in size; not on the picture)
